Mental Health: My Personal Journey | Ep. 02
Some days, I feel like I’m on top of the world—like I can do anything, be anything. And then, there are days when just getting out of bed feels impossible. That’s the reality of living with bipolar type 2 and adult ADHD. It’s messy, unpredictable, and sometimes, just downright exhausting. I believe there is hope and victory for those with ADHD and bipolar.
In this episode, I’m pulling back the curtain on my mental health journey—the highs, the lows, and everything in between. I talk about depression, or as I like to call it, my “dead cat” days (yeah, we’re going there), and the manic moments that make me feel invincible… until they don’t.
But I’m not just here to vent. I’m sharing the things that actually help—things like therapy, faith, lifting heavy weights (because why not), and making my space feel like a sanctuary. Because managing mental health isn’t just about surviving—it’s about finding joy in the midst of it all.

About Chrisette Michele:
Chrisette Michele is a Grammy Award Winning Recording Artist, Newly Crowned Ted x Talk Speaker who has just launched her brand-new podcast “Come Back Sis”. She’s weathered the journey of a 15-year career topping the Billboard Pop and R&B charts, collaborating with artists from Jay Z to John Legend and touring the world. She’s experienced cancel culture firsthand, love, marriage and divorce and the stigmas that come with adult ADHD and Bi-Polar Type 2, all in the public eye. Her podcast “The Chrisette Michele Podcast” is where Chrisette Michele invites guests and friends to offer encouragement, hope and personal methods to inner peace, no matter the storm.
